Understanding Watts in a 12V Outdoor Power Supply

If you've ever wondered, "How many watts does a 12V outdoor power supply provide?" the answer depends on its current (amps). Watts = Volts × Amps. For example:

  • A 12V/10A power supply delivers 120 watts (12 × 10).
  • A 12V/30A unit provides 360 watts (12 × 30).

But why does this matter? Whether you're powering LED lights or a portable fridge, knowing your wattage ensures compatibility and prevents overloads.

Key Factors Affecting Wattage Output

Not all 12V power supplies are equal. Consider these factors:

  • Efficiency Loss: Wires and inverters can reduce usable power by 10–15%.
  • Peak vs. Continuous Load: Devices like motors require extra startup power.
  • Temperature: Extreme heat or cold impacts battery performance.

How to Choose the Right 12V Power Supply

Follow these steps:

  1. List all devices and their wattage requirements.
  2. Add a 20% buffer for safety.
  3. Select a battery with sufficient amp-hours (Ah).

Pro Tip: For solar setups, pair your battery with a charge controller rated for 25% higher current than your panels.

FAQ: 12V Outdoor Power Supply Basics

Q: Can I connect multiple 12V batteries? A: Yes! Wiring batteries in parallel increases capacity (Ah), while series connections boost voltage.

Q: How long will a 12V/100Ah battery last? A> At 50% discharge depth, it delivers 600Wh (12V × 50Ah). Running a 60W device? 600 ÷ 60 = 10 hours.
